Basic Information

CAS Registry Number: 30499-70-8
Molecular Formula: C9H19ClO4
Molecular Mass: 226.70 g/mol

Names and Synonyms:

1,3-Propanediol, 2-Ethyl-2-(Hydroxymethyl)-, Polymer With 2-(Chloromethyl)Oxirane
1,3-Propanediol, 2-ethyl-2-(hydroxymethyl)-, polymer with 2-(chloromethyl)oxirane
Trimethylolpropane-epichlorohydrin copolymer
2-Ethyl-2-(hydroxymethyl)-1,3-propanediol polymer with (chloromethyl)oxirane
T 856506
1,3-Propanediol, 2-ethyl-2-(hydroxymethyl)-, polymer with (chloromethyl)oxirane
Oxirane, (chloromethyl)-, polymer with 2-ethyl-2-(hydroxymethyl)-1,3-propanediol
Epichlorohydrin-trimethylolpropane copolymer
Triepoxide 427-61
Denacol EX 320
Epichlorohydrin-trimethylolpropane polymer
Oksilin 5
